Old/Roman Bridge 🌉 Tavira

Highlight • Bridge

Despite its name, the bridge itself is neither Roman nor has a Roman origin. It was built when Tavira belonged to al-Andalus (the Islamic Domain of Iberia), most probably in the 2nd half of the 12th century. Then, for a few decades Tavira was an independent commune, before being submitted to the Almohade Empire.
The bridge was a fundamental element of the medieval defence of Tavira and its associated main road, limited with towers in both sides. It had houses on it in the Middle Ages. By 1550 it had apparently a movable wooden floor which could be removed for security reasons. The old bridge collapsed in 1655, then completely rebuilt in its present form. tavira.algarvetouristguide.com/attractions/the-old-roman-bridge

A very well-developed cycle path with the following destinations:

Olhão is a city in Portugal with 14,206 inhabitants (as of April 19, 2021). Olhão is located in the so-called Sand Algarve, the Sotavento. This is the name given to the region that stretches between Faro Airport and the Spanish border in eastern Portugal.

Among the numerous architectural monuments are a number of historic public buildings, various social housing blocks from the Estado Novo regime, the 17th-century fortress, and two Baroque parish churches. The historic town center as a whole is also a protected monument, and a tidal mill can be visited just outside the city.

The Ria Formosa Natural Park is a nature park surrounding a lagoon in the southern Portuguese Algarve. With a protected area of 170 km², the lagoon is one of the largest lagoonal nature reserves in Europe. The lagoon itself covers 83.5 km².

Fuseta, also known as Fuzeta, is a town and former municipality on the Algarve coast in southern Portugal. The German author Holger Karsten Schmidt, writing under the pseudonym Gil Ribeiro, created a crime series set here.

Gilão River 🌊 Tavira

Highlight • River

The wetlands trails can be explored by bike, but to cross the Rio Gilão either cross one of the historic pedestrian bridges in town or this modern coastal highway bridge. All three offer great views of the estuary and the old town.

Tavira is a beautiful coastal town on Portugal's Algarve coast. It lies on the Gilão River, which flows into the sea via estuaries and lagoons in the Ria Formosa Natural Park. Tavira Island boasts a long sandy beach and salt flats that attract flamingos, spoonbills, and other wading birds. The medieval Castelo de Tavira is located in the town center and offers panoramic views. The Church of Santa María do Castelo houses the tombs of seven knights killed by the Moors. The Gilão River flows through the center of Tavira and plays a significant role in the city's history and life. It flows into the Ria Formosa lagoon, making Tavira an important trading and fishing center in the past. Along its banks lie characteristic white houses, bridges, and pleasant promenades. The river is lined with cafés, restaurants, and parks, such as the Jardim do Coreto, making it a beautiful place to stroll, enjoy the views, and experience Tavira's local atmosphere.

What is the significance of the Ria Formosa Natural Park?

The Ria Formosa Natural Park is one of Europe's largest lagoonal nature reserves, covering 170 km². It's a vital wetland ecosystem surrounding a lagoon, known for its extensive salt flats, diverse birdlife (including flamingos and spoonbills), and barrier islands like Tavira Island with its long sandy beach. It's a protected area crucial for biodiversity and offers unique natural landscapes.

Is there anything unique about the Gilão River in Tavira?

The Gilão River 🌊 Tavira is central to Tavira's identity, flowing through the city center and into the Ria Formosa lagoon. It's lined with characteristic white houses, bridges, and pleasant promenades, making it a beautiful spot for a stroll. Legend has it that the river's two names (Séqua upstream, Gilão downstream) come from a tragic love story between a Moorish princess and a Christian knight.
